Journal ArticleDOI
ModelTest-NG: a new and scalable tool for the selection of DNA and protein evolutionary models
Diego Darriba,David Posada,Alexey M. Kozlov,Alexandros Stamatakis,Alexandros Stamatakis,Benoit Morel,Tomas Flouri +6 more
TL;DR: ModelTest-NG is a reimplementation from scratch of jModelTest and ProtTest, two popular tools for selecting the best-fit nucleotide and amino acid substitution models, respectively, and introduces several new features, such as ascertainment bias correction, mixture, and free-rate models, or the automatic processing of single partitions.
